This formula has been instrumental in the design of numerous transportation and public works projects around the world. While studying traffic in Baltimore, Maryland, Alan Voorhees developed a mathematical formula to predict traffic patterns based on land use. The most widely used formulation is still the gravity model. The next models developed were the gravity model and the intervening opportunities model. (Simple Growth factor model, Furness Model and Detroit model are models developed at the same time period) This structure extrapolated a base year trip table to the future based on growth, but took no account of changing spatial accessibility due to increased supply or changes in travel patterns and congestion. The first was the Fratar or Growth model (which did not differentiate trips by purpose). Over the years, modelers have used several different formulations of trip distribution. There are trip distribution models for other (non-work) activities such as the choice of location for grocery shopping, which follow the same structure. Work trip distribution is the way that travel demand models understand how people take jobs. from zone 1 to zone 1, is zero since no intra-zonal trip occurs.

Table: Illustrative trip table Origin \ Destination Historically, this component has been the least developed component of the transportation planning model. This step matches tripmakers’ origins and destinations to develop a “trip table”, a matrix that displays the number of trips going from each origin to each destination. Trip distribution (or destination choice or zonal interchange analysis) is the second component (after trip generation, but before mode choice and route assignment) in the traditional four-step transportation forecasting model. All trips have an origin and destination and these are considered at the trip distribution stage.
